Biography
Brenda Barnes joined the University of Oklahoma College of Law in 2006. She teaches and supervises Licensed Legal Interns in the Civil and Criminal Divisions of the Clinic. In addition, she co-teaches Litigation Skills.Brenda Barnes went to private practice immediately upon graduation in 1999. She handled a diverse case load representing individuals in Family, Juvenile, and Criminal Law.Professor Barnes served as the defense attorney on the Cleveland County Juvenile Drug Court Team and was the recipient of the University of Oklahoma College of Law Kelly Beardslee Criminal Defense Award in 1999 and the Cleveland County Outstanding Service to the Community Award in 2006.
